RED HOT + FELA Set for Release Today on Knitting Factory Records
by BWW News Desk - Oct 8, 2013

Fela Kuti lives on. Since his death in 1997, he's been transformed from musician's musician with a cult-like following to a worldwide musical icon. The last four years have seen the Broadway hit FELA! win Tony Awards and tour the world, Knitting Factory Records reissue the prolific Nigerian firebrand's back catalogue, and now, Red Hot.
